WebOct 12, 2011 · To refinish a refrigerator or other an appliance: Remove the handles from the appliance. Sand any rusty spots on the appliance. Clean the surface thoroughly to remove any grease or grime. Spray a rust inhibiting primer on any bare metal. Apply painter’s tape around the inside of the door. Stir the Liquid Stainless Steel coating thoroughly. WebJun 18, 2015 · Theoretically, high-grade stainless steel can last a lifetime, provided it's well maintained. That's because the surface of stainless steel is protected by a nanometer-thin layer of chromium and iron oxides. Amazingly, that coating is self healing—but you can still fatally wound it. Surface preparation is SUPER important! A well prepared surface will ensure a durable paint finish. Remove the handles and vent cover (if any) and thoroughly clean the fridge surface and all the parts with soap and water. Let the paste sit on the object for an hour or so. Use steel wool or a wire brush to scour the object and remove the rust. Rinse the paste off with water and dry thoroughly. low fat oatmeal cookieWebApr 28, 2024 · Mix your rust removal solution using two cups of hot water, two cups of white vinegar, and ¼ cup of lemon juice.
